Understanding the Fundamentals of Teenpatti
At its core, teenpatti, meaning «three cards» in Hindi, is a simple game to learn but difficult to master. Each player is dealt three cards face down, and the gameplay revolves around betting rounds where players either ‘call’ (match the current bet), ‘raise’ (increase the bet), or ‘fold’ (withdraw from the round). The ultimate goal is to have the best three-card hand or to bluff opponents into folding, even with a weak hand. The suspense builds with each round, creating a dynamic and engaging experience. A successful player needs to combine a solid understanding of probability with the ability to read opponents.
The pot, comprised of the bets made by the players, goes to the player with the highest-ranking hand at the showdown – assuming at least two players remain. However, a player can also win the pot by being the last one remaining after all other players fold. This emphasis on bluffing introduces a mental dimension to the game, separating it from purely chance-based card games. It’s a game where calculated risks can yield substantial rewards.
| Trail/Set | Three cards of the same rank (e.g., three 7s) | 0.14% |
| Pure Sequence/Straight Flush | Three consecutive cards of the same suit (e.g., 5♥ 6♥ 7♥) | 0.12% |
| Sequence/Straight | Three consecutive cards of different suits (e.g., 5♥ 6♣ 7♦) | 0.6% |
| Flush | Three cards of the same suit, not in sequence | 3.03% |
| Pair | Two cards of the same rank and one unmatched card | 21.13% |
| High Card | No matching ranks or sequences | 54.12% |
Decoding Card Rankings in Teenpatti
Understanding the hand rankings is arguably the most crucial aspect of mastering teenpatti. As the table above illustrates, the ranking begins with the most coveted hand – a Trail or Set – where all three cards share the same rank. Following this, a Pure Sequence (Straight Flush) claims the second spot, commanding significant respect at the table. A regular Sequence (Straight) and Flush are ranked next, offering higher chances of winning than purely relying on a Pair or the basic High Card hand. Knowing these rankings allows players to evaluate their hand strength objectively.

Reading Your Opponents: Beyond the Cards
Teenpatti is not solely about the cards you hold; it’s also about deciphering your opponents’ behavior. Experienced players become adept at recognizing tells – subtle clues in their opponents’ body language or betting patterns – that reveal the strength or weakness of their hand. Are they hesitant before raising? Are their bets consistently small or aggressively large? These observations can provide valuable hints. Remember though, savvy players may deliberately attempt to mislead you!
Observing betting patterns is crucial. An aggressive player constantly raising indicates confidence, potentially holding a strong hand, or attempting to bluff. Conversely, a passive player consistently checking or calling could suggest a weak hand or a desire to lure others into the game. However, it’s important to avoid jumping to conclusions based on a single observation. Looking for patterns and combining behavioral analysis with an understanding of the game’s probabilities yields the best results.

Managing Your Bankroll and Responsible Gaming
Effective bankroll management is crucial for long-term success in teenpatti. Determine a budget you’re willing to lose before starting to play, and stick to it. Avoid chasing losses, as this can lead to reckless decisions and further financial setbacks. Treat teenpatti as a form of entertainment, not a guaranteed source of income. When you have reached your loss limit, either stop playing completely or reduce your stakes significantly. Automate this process if possible.
Responsible gaming also involves recognizing the signs of problem gambling and seeking help if needed. These signs include spending more time and money on the game than intended, lying to others about your gambling habits, or experiencing negative emotional consequences as a result of your playing. Numerous resources are available to provide support and guidance for individuals struggling with gambling addiction. Prioritizing your well-being is essential.
